All the hotel facilities are modern and spotless clean. Our room was very comfortable, and overall bigger than expected. The hotel staff are friendly, helpful, and very nice. The food quality and range in the all-inclusive restaurant is amazing, there were always many options to choose from, for any kind of diet or preference. I want to specifically highlight the awesome desserts, and also cocktails at the bar are of really high quality, which exceeded my expectations. We also enjoyed the evening entertainment, having a cocktail with a view and some beautiful live music after dinner was amazing! Overall I would totally recommend this hotel.
We booked a swim-up suite with a private pool entrance, and overall it was fine, but we couldn't use it as much as we wanted to because there is no shade and it's direct sunlight all day long. This could easily be solved by just adding sun umbrellas to these suites. The room cleaning was sometimes intrusive, they would repeatedly knock and try to get in even as I was in the shower and put a "do not disturb" sign on the door. The breakfast is too early and not well synced with other facilities. Breakfast is until 9:30, and you should really come earlier, because after 9 it just felt like everything was a bit in disarray and not much food was left. Meanwhile, the pool bar and the towel service only started working from 9:30-10. The towels pickup and drop off is at the spa, inside the hotel, and it's a bit of a walk, especially from the beach. It could be stationed closer to the beach and the pool. Finally, the hotel doesn't have good coffee. It's a bummer especially at breakfast. They serve capsules, or low quality filter coffee at the main restaurant, and you can only get real coffee at the bar if you make a special request. Please invest in some quality beans and a few coffee machines, it's honestly expected in a hotel of such a level. I also didn't like the policy of sunbed "loungers", as they cost 50-100 euro per day, and most other non-extra options are occupied by guests who apparently wake up at 6am to reserve the beds, especially at the pool. Finally, the bedroom mattress was really uncomfortable because it was 2 single mattresses on a double bed, and we were constantly sliding into the gap. Overall, if they invest in some improvements I think this is a really good hotel. These points are what's keeping it from being exceptional.

The staff were very friendly. They really put effort or make your stay better. Appreciate it. The cats were very sweet. The hotel made cat houses for them, they’re treated nicely.
The whole system was weird from the start to the end. We made a reservation for half board, thinking that only difference will be lunch and drinks won’t be included. It was more than that. All inclusive gets beach towels, sunbeds, priority in reserving the spa. There is even a bar only all inclusive can enter (which is super weird) and so many other little but annoying things… But it’s the deal we got, so I can understand it to level (wish the information was better though). The reason I gave a low star is: 1. Food is not good. I’m sorry to say that, it’s an okay food. The variety at the buffet is good. But everything is tasteless and low quality. If you’re in Greece, you can easily find much better food in any taverna out there. The Greek food offerings were very limited. You get pizza, pasta etc every night. Breakfast is also very standard and nothing special about it. I found hair few times in my food and the plates at the open buffet was not clean all the time. 2. The open buffet is a mass! It’s so crowded and stressful trying get food. 3. The room was very cold at night and there was no way to heat it. The air co is only for cooling down. If you’re visiting in April & May, keep this in mind. We had to ask extra blankets. The room was nice, but we did not really enjoy it because of the cold. 4. The bar is expensive! I had the most expensive tea of my life in the smallest cup. Water is expensive, fundamental things are not complementary in a resort. It’s RIDICULOUS to ask for extra 35 euros for the beds around the pool! It’s an all inclusive resort, this was quite disappointing. 5. The outdoor pool is not heated as advertised. It’s a one meter pool anyways, not fun to swim. For such a big resort there is only one pool option and it’s not like it’s looking in the pictures. The bottom was very dirty on top. 6.
